The Nicolas Meier World Group | Guildford Jazz at the Cricket Pavilion
Thu 29 May |The Nicolas Meier World Group | Guildford Jazz at the Cricket Pavilion | Woodbridge Road, Guildford GU1 4RP | Jazz from 19.15 to 22.15 | Tickets £20 (Discounts for Members and Students) from here
The World Group has a unique sound, incorporating Middle Eastern, Turkish, jazz and fusion influences. Meier’s career has included three years of touring with Jeff Beck and subsequent recordings with bassist Jimmy Haslip and Vinnie Collaiuta. The World Group offers a range of colours – Nick plays various types of guitars and the group benefits from Richard Jones’ electric violin and the keyboard wizardry of Alex Hutton. With bassist, Tom Mason and the talented percussionist, Demi Garcia-Sabat.

Guildford Jazz at the Stoke | Rod Youngs Quartet featuring Denys Baptiste
Fri 11 Apr | Guildford Jazz at the Stoke | Rod Youngs Quartet featuring Denys Baptiste | 103 Stoke Road Guildford GU1 4JN | Jazz from 19:15 to 22:30 | Tickets £20 (Discounts for Members and Students) from here
MOBO nominated musician Rod Youngs celebrates the music of the iconic Blue Note Record label. Rod has established himself as one of the most expressive and versatile drummers on the contemporary music scene. For over two decades his approach to music has covered a wide spectrum of genres while remaining firmly rooted in the jazz tradition. Rod is joined by the incomparable Denys Baptiste, a legend of British jazz and one of the most sought-after saxophonists in the country. With guitarist Artie Zaitz and bassist Larry Bartley.

Guildford Jazz at the University of Surrey | Huw Warren “Choro, Choro, Choro”
Thu 25 Mar | Guildford Jazz at the University of Surrey | Huw Warren “Choro, Choro, Choro” | Performing Arts Studio (PATS), University of Surrey, Guildford, Surrey, GU2 7XH | Jazz from 7.30 to 10.15 | Tickets £20 (Discounts for Members and Students) from here
Celebrating Choro, the vibrant beating heart of Brazilian music, “Choro, Choro, Choro” explores music from the 1880’s to the present day by composers such as Ernesto Nazareth, Chiquinha Gonzaga, Pixinguinha, and modern masters such as Guinga and Hermeto Pascoal. Huw Warren has created several projects around the music of Brazil, including collaborations with Jovino Santos Neto, a critically acclaimed recording of Hermeto’s music in 2009 and a trio record for CAM Jazz ‘Everything in Between’ in 2019. With Huw Warren – piano, Tori Freestone – saxophone/flute, Andrew Bain – drums and Yuri Goloubev – drums.
